Call 800.716.7608 to speak with a FreightCenter Freight Agent.To calculate the density and class, follow these steps or use the calculator below. First measure the height, width, and depth of the shipment. In taking these measurements you must be sure to measure to the farthest points, including pallets or other packaging. NMFC codes are similar in concept to PLU codes at a grocery store — every item that could be shipped is assigned a code. For example, hardwood flooring may be assigned NMFC #37860, whereas corrugated boxes may be assigned NMFC #29250. Multiply the dimensions (L x W x H) to determine the total cubic inches of the handling unit. Divide the total cubic inches by 1728 to convert to total cubic feet. Divide the total handling unit weight (including packaging and pallet weight) by the total cubic feet to determine the handling unit density. Functional.1. Divide the total weight by total cubic feet of the shipment to get the lbs/ cubic ft (as shown in the reference chart above).Dimensional weight in kg per package = Length x Height x Width in cm / 5,000. This dimensional weight calculation for FedEx Express® services applies to Europe, Middle-East, Africa and the Indian Subcontinent (EMEA), EMEA export and EMEA import shipments. Free packaging.
